A Study of Assistive Communication Device Improvement for Visually Impaired People with Multiple Disabilities Using Facial Feature Detection and Tracking Systems

The object of this thesis is to improve the assistive communication device by facial feature detection and tracking systems to solve the communication problems without words in daily lives for visually impaired people with multiple disabilities. In the study, the images of head shaking are captured into a notebook through a webcam. The facial feature (nose) is detected and tracked by the Haar algorithm. The moving position of the nose center is computed to identify the directions of head shaking, and then the communication operations of Pinyin, associating Chinese character, and debugging error are processed. Finally, the voice communication and text output are achieved by the combined text-to-speech editor. The improvement of the assistive communication device is accomplished for visually impaired people with multiple disabilities using facial feature detection and tracking systems. The results of this thesis can improve that visually impaired people with multiple disabilities directly operate the facial feature detection and tracking systems for voice communication. In addition to increasing convenience of assistive communication in daily life, it can also improve the communication with the outside world, the better learning ability and living independently for visually impaired people with multiple disabilities.
